Valencia Cathedral: Ancient ventilation system is key to discreet ASD protection.

The 700-year-old Cathedral of Valencia is a cultural jewel that reflects the history of the city in its stones. Protecting such a priceless building from fire is important, but so is preserving its stunning interior aesthetics. Securiton’s highly capable SecuriSmoke ASD Heavy Duty systems are able to do both, by working alongside the natural ventilation designed by the cathedral’s medieval architects.

Modern fire safety meets ancient architecture

 

Built between the 13th and 15th centuries, the cathedral offers a unique Valencian Gothic architecture, having been initially constructed in a hurry to mark the city’s reconquest by the Christians. Built on the site of an earlier Visigothic cathedral that the city’s Moorish inhabitants had turned into a mosque, it was consecrated in 1238 by the first bishop of Valencia, and the initial building phase was completed by 1350 – fast by medieval standards!Further buildings were added in the following century, including the famous Miguelete Tower, and in 1459 the ar-chitects Francesc Baldomar and Pere Compte expanded the nave and tran-septs in a further section which brought everything together in one sprawling and majestic building. Ornamentation in the cathedral’s magnificent vaulted interior developed in later centuries and includes a painting by Goya.


Damaged once by fire in the Spanish Civil War, the challenges of discretely protecting such a complex building from further damage are considerable. Using Performance-based Design, Securiton International’s Spanish technical team devised a system that involved sampling air exiting the cathedral’s ancient roof vents, using capillaries from sampling tubes mounted on the exterior façade and roof.
In order to achieve this, and have a system that still offers longevity, reliability and straightforward maintenance, four ASD 535-4HDs and one 535-3HD were used, connected via FidesNet for easy monitoring on-site. Following Performance-based Design principles, the system was tested using smoke and has been approved by local fire authorities.
